Transaction 623b2a1c31fef70b44d75792f417896ff400e084663e2777a9215fabc2d05d1b
1 Input
1 Output
-
623b2a1c31fef70b44d75792f417896ff400e084663e2777a9215fabc2d05d1b:0
- value
- 447127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 449f134c84b0f888b080d1cc24ed30c58db74865 OP_EQUAL
- address
- 37wrSLfSyeEcS7ERVb1AQLPPFtVoJxh7Rb